relating to medical assistance for individuals residing in certain | ||
institutions. | ||
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: | ||
SECTION 1. Section 32.025, Human Resources Code, is amended | ||
by adding Subsections (g) and (h) to read as follows: | ||
(g) The department shall accept an application for medical | ||
assistance from a person residing in a nursing home who is applying | ||
for that assistance under 42 U.S.C. Section 1396a(a)(10)(A)(ii)(V) | ||
regardless of whether the person has resided in the nursing home for | ||
the period required for eligibility by that section. | ||
(h) The department may not determine the eligibility for | ||
medical assistance of a person whose application is accepted under | ||
Subsection (g) until the period required for eligibility by 42 | ||
U.S.C. Section 1396a(a)(10)(A)(ii)(V) has elapsed. | ||
SECTION 2. If before implementing any provision of this Act | ||
a state agency determines that a waiver or authorization from a | ||
federal agency is necessary for implementation of that provision, | ||
the agency affected by the provision shall request the waiver or | ||
authorization and may delay implementing that provision until the | ||
waiver or authorization is granted. | ||
SECTION 3. This Act takes effect immediately if it receives | ||
a vote of two-thirds of all the members elected to each house, as | ||
provided by Section 39, Article III, Texas Constitution. If this | ||
Act does not receive the vote necessary for immediate effect, this | ||
Act takes effect September 1, 2013. |
